Affordable wedding dresses in Knoxville/Nashville?

I'm not looking for anything overly fancy and I've seen some things I like at David's Bridal but I'm really hesatant to go with them after all the horror stories that I've heard about them. Most of the dresses I like are "destination" type dresses. I'd ideally like to spend $600 or less on a dress. I'm in the knoxville area but can easily travel to Nashville.

  • I got mine last year at the Dash for the Dress at Jubilee Banquet hall. it was a fun event and I got my $1200 for $200. I don't know if they're doing it again this year or not, but it was totally worth it! :)
    Otherwise, you can see if you can find any clearance prom/homecoming dresses. That was going to be my other option, because I had found one on sale for $15 :)

    I love this event, and just have to tell you girls to check it out.  If you are looking for a designer gown, there are stores from all over TN that come to Knoxville for one day a year to sell out their discontinued sample gowns.  Such an awesome experience, and all of the gowns are priced at $200, $400, and $600.  My BFF found her gown there last year.  It was an $1800 Maggie Sottero for $400.  Seriously.
